The time for the Oldham-Ramona-Rutland School District's public dissolution vote is drawing near, with the school board set to approve its election date at a special meeting on Oct. 27.
The meeting will take place at 5:30 p.m. in the Rutland gym, where board members will discuss the proposed election date of Dec. 16. The date was selected by the South Dakota Department of Education following its approval of the ORR reorganization plan. The meeting will also see the DOE-approved plan added to the district's official minutes. ×
